If there is a demand for something then the product will be there, it's as simple as that.
I think it should be legalised because then the women are in less danger, if they don't like the look of someone then they won't have to do anything with him/her and they're safer.
Also, it would then be easier for these women to get regular health check ups.
Legalising would also help stop the *** trafficking industry because any woman who is a ********** out of their own will would be registered and obviously any woman who is forced into it can be saved. It would also stop underage girls from falling into the trap.
One of the reasons that the government won't legalise it is because it's difficult to tax, pretty sad if you ask me.
